I applied online. The process took 4 weeks. I interviewed at Optym (Gainesville, FL) in June 2014
Interview
The interview process consists of 3 rounds. The first round are two written tests about logic, data structure, algorithms, operations research, database manipulation and object-oriented programming. The second round is a 30-minute phone interview about data structure and algorithms. The final round is an on-site interview with several current employees from different backgrounds.

I applied through university. The process took 3 months. I interviewed at Optym
Interview
Mine started with a 3-hour test at home. A few days later they invited me for an on-site interview which included another 3-hour test, harder than the previous one, and 5 f2f interviews with current employees.
